| My story with west nile
When i was 16, getting ready for my first day at football practice for highschool. After the 2nd week i started to get a bit of a sore throat. I thought nothing of it so i just left it alone. Then after the next practice i started getting these red dots all over my legs and arms, I asked my coach what these were and he said they were just heat rash. Then the symptoms started to pile on left and right. I went to the doctor got some tests done to see what i had they put me on amoxicillian and sent me home for some rest. I had bad headaches 24/7, fever, extreme pains in legs(could barely stand up), I had a stiff neck, I was confused all the time, my muscles were very weak, and i passed out a few times. It took a few weeks for one set of my results too come back in and my doctor said i had a mucus pnemonia and the amoxicillian was not strong enough to help me, so they had to put me on pills that were around 10$ a pill but boy ill tell ya they sure worked. I think it took me about a month for me to fully recover, and my doctors think it may have given me some nerve damage in my legs. I pray to god that no one else had to go through what i went through. About 2 weeks after i recovered the hospital called and said i tested positive for west nile. I hope they've speeded up the proccess of getting that test done quicker because a month and a half may be to late for someone.
